Page 150 of 256

TOYOTA tC 2006   (in English) User Guide 142
Anti–lock brake system is not de-
signed to shorten the stopping dis-
tance: Always drive at a moderate
speed and maintain a safe distance
from the vehicle in front of you.

TOYOTA tC 2006   (in English) User Guide 194
Exterior lights: Wash carefully. Do not use
organic substances or scrub them with a
hard brush. This may damage the sur-
faces of the lights.
